Sometimes the best way to handle a storm is to step away from it, and that seems to be exactly what Princess Beatrice and Princess Eugenie are doing as pressure mounts on their parents, Prince Andrew and Sarah Ferguson.

According to The Mirror, the sisters appear to “have quietly left the country while scrutiny on their parents intensified.” The renewed attention follows fresh reports about Andrew and Ferguson’s ties to conv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ein. Even their decision to voluntarily relinquish royal titles and honors has done little to calm public outrage.

The pair have also been under growing pressure to leave Royal Lodge, their 30-room mansion in Windsor Great Park, which they’ve lived in since 2003. The property has become a symbol of their lingering connection to royal privilege despite repeated scandals.

As the situation worsened, both Beatrice and Eugenie were spotted abroad. The Mirror reports that Beatrice traveled to Saudi Arabia, where she attended the Future Investment Initiative in Riyadh. She was seen at the same event last year while pregnant with her daughter, Athena.

Eugenie, meanwhile, has been seen in a much lighter setting. Interior designer Sterling McDavid shared an Instagram post from what appeared to be a recent girls’ trip to Paris. The post included a selfie of Eugenie by the River Seine with McDavid and art adviser Sarah Calodney, the Eiffel Tower glowing in the background.

The Mirror noted that “it is not known if either has yet returned to the U.K.” Their quiet departures come as the family faces fresh strain behind the scenes. After Andrew announced he would no longer use his royal titles, Beatrice was spotted attending what was described as a “York family summit” at Royal Lodge. Eugenie, however, did not attend.

“The Royal Lodge ‘summit’ wasn’t a happy occasion and the family, once a strong unit, is fractured,” a royal insider told the Daily Mail of Eugenie’s absence.

Beatrice, though present, appeared visibly shaken afterwards. The Daily Mail reported she looked “distressed-looking” as she left Royal Lodge following the tense meeting.

“She was on the phone saying she couldn’t bring herself to look at the Sunday papers,” a royal source told the outlet. “She looked absolutely devastated.”

The sisters’ decision to spend time abroad may be a bid for normality—or simply space—amid their family’s latest wave of controversy. With their parents once again at the centre of royal scandal, Beatrice and Eugenie appear to be doing what anyone might when family drama gets too loud: stepping away until the dust settles.
